Top-four clashes in the FA Women’s National League Premier divisions see Wolves face Rugby Borough and Ipswich Town take on Watford.

Just one point separates the top four, as leaders Nottingham Forest host Halifax, fourth plays second with Wolves home to Rugby and third-placed Burnley entertaining Derby.

Hashtag got to Wimbledon as leaders by three points from Ipswich, who have two games in hand but go up against fourth-placed Watford. Oxford are level on points with Ipswich from two games more and hosting Cheltenham.
